Table 4.

Multivariate Associations Between Age and Park Use and PA Among Neighborhood Residents

No. of visits to parks in last 7 days (n = 1,950) Typical duration of park visit (min; n = 1,374)
Characteristics Mean [95% CI] Mean [95% CI]
Individual
 intercept 0.78 [−0.97, 2.54] 93.0 [33.7, 152.3]**
 females having children <18 years old (vs. male) −0.83 [−1.52, −0.13]* −33.0 [−52.0, −14.0]***
 females not having children <18 years old (vs. male) −0.96 [−1.52, −0.41]** −27.5 [−44.1, −11.0]**
 age × males −0.014 [−0.023, −0.005]** −0.8 [−1.0, −0.5]***
 age × females not having children <18 years old (vs. age × males) 0.009 [−0.003, 0.021] 0.4 [0.0, 0.7]*
 age × females having children <18 years old (vs. age × males) 0.019 [0.002, 0.036]* 0.6 [0.1, 1.1]*
 Black vs. Whites/others 0.08 [−0.25, 0.40] 8.8 [−0.7, 18.3]
 Latino vs. Whites/others −0.30 [−0.56, −0.05]* −4.7 [−11.9, 2.6]
 High School graduate (vs. <HS) 0.04 [−0.16, 0.23] 1.1 [−4.7, 6.9]
 some college (vs. <HS) 0.31 [0.07, 0.56]* −1.3 [−8.3, 5.7]
 college graduate (vs. <HS) 0.35 [0.08, 0.62]* −7.3 [−15.0, 0.4]
 obese (BMI > 30) 0.07 [−0.13, 0.26] 3.9 [−1.8, 9.5]
 fair or poor health status 0.36 [0.15, 0.57]*** 2.3 [−4.0, 8.6]
 lives 0–¼ mile from park (vs. >½ mile) 0.74 [0.57, 0.92]*** −3.8 [−9.0, 1.4]
 lives ¼–½ mile from park (vs. >½ mile) 0.29 [0.11, 0.47]** 2.2 [−3.3, 7.6]
 perceives park as safe 0.29 [0.11, 0.48]** 9.8 [3.6, 15.9]**
 screen time (12 hr) vs. 0–60 min 0.17 [−0.12, 0.45] −1.8 [−10.0, 6.4]
 screen time (2–4 hr) vs. 0–60 min 0.06 [−0.21, 0.33] 1.8 [−6.2, 9.8]
 screen time (4+ hr) vs. 0–60 min 0.21 [−0.08, 0.50] 3.8 [−4.7, 12.4]
 currently works full time −0.13 [−0.30, 0.04] 1.4 [−3.6, 6.3]
 currently works part time 0.42 [0.20, 0.64]*** −0.7 [−6.8, 5.4]
Park
 acres 0.03 [0.00, 0.05]* 0.0 [−0.8, 0.9]
 observed number of park users 0.00 [0.00, 0.01] 0.3 [0.1, 0.5]**
 %male park users 0.00 [−0.02, 0.02] 0.2 [−0.6, 1.0]
 number of organized activity sessions 0.00 [−0.02, 0.01] −0.2 [−0.7, 0.2]
Neighborhood
 number of total crimes 6 months after start of baseline observation 0.00 [0.00, 0.00] 0.0 [−0.1, 0.0]
 %households in poverty within 1 mile 0.00 [−0.02, 0.02] −0.2 [−0.7, 0.4]
 pop. within 1 mile 0.01 [−0.07, 0.10] −0.3 [−3.4, 2.8]

Note. Boldface indicates statistical significance. BMI = body mass index; CI = confidence interval; HS = high school.

*

p < .05.

**

p < .01.

***

p < .001.
